Just so I'm sure... This is on your phone? What browser specifically?

This is a common symptom of an infected PC/device. You click on a link from google/wherever and the page starts to pop up and you get re-directed to a porn/malware site.

It could be that avast simply didn't recognize the virus. That happens all to often. The virus could be so new the virus scanner doesn't have a definition to see it yet.

Make sure it has the latest definitions, perhaps try a different AV product.

If this was on a PC I would say use Malwarebytes since it is far superior to any Anti-Virus I've ever used...

I now also scanned my phone with AVG and trustgo antivirus. Trustgo pointed talking tom the cat as 'high risk' which would be strange since its a really popular app.

Could be a false positive. But it may be because of the ads bundled with it, sometimes those ads are for spammy stuff. You may have accidentally clicked one.

How do you mean you reloaded android forums? You just deleted the bookmark and reloaded it?

If it happens again I would clear cache and/or data from browser
